Subject:   SCHED_ULE and priorities
Message-ID:  <20030205053818.GA7582@rot13.obsecurity.org>

next in thread | raw e-mail | index | archive | help

[-- Attachment #1 --]
I just booted a kernel with SCHED_ULE.  It looks like there's a pretty
serious bug:

  PID USERNAME PRI NICE   SIZE    RES STATE    TIME   WCPU    CPU COMMAND
  573 dnetc    139   20  1000K   804K RUN      1:29 85.94% 85.94% dnetc
  661 kris      96    0  2252K  1496K RUN      0:00  6.25%  6.25% top
  590 root      96    0 28620K 28128K select   0:04  3.12%  3.12% XFree86
  641 root     120    0  4856K  4744K RUN      0:03  3.12%  3.12% make
 
The make you see there was a 'make -j4' in /usr/src/secure.  It has
been sitting there for about 5 minutes having done nothing other than:

citusc17# make all -j4
===> lib
===> lib/libcipher
===> lib/libtelnet
===> lib/libcrypto
